Use FTP URL in Web Browser
How to use FTP URL in Web browser to access a FTP resource?
✍: FYIcenter.com
You can follow these steps to use FTP URL in Web browser to access a FTP resource:
1. Compose the FTP URL with the FTP server access information. For example, ftp://anynoymous:me@ftp.funet.fi/pub/standards/RFC/rfc959.txt.
2. Start a Web browser, Google Chrome.
3. Type in the FTP URL into the browser address box and press Enter. The content of the FTP resource will be displayed, if possible. Otherwise, you will be prompted to save the resource as a file.
